# 54291 Johnny Trail, Hannibal, MO 63401

> **TL;DR:** 4bd/2ba single family, $379,900 ($134/sqft), built 2017, 2,844 sqft.
> Basement. Est. $1,646/mo.

## Property at a Glance

| Attribute | Value |
|-----------|-------|
| Price | $379,900 |
| Price/sqft | $134 |
| Bedrooms | 4 |
| Bathrooms | 2 full |
| Square Feet | 2,844 |
| Year Built | 2017 |
| Lot Size | 81,457 sqft (1.87 acres) |
| Stories | 1 |
| Property Type | Single Family (Single Family Residence) |
| Status | For Sale |
| Days on Market | 0 |

## Estimated Monthly Costs

| Category | Amount |
|----------|--------|
| Mortgage (20% down, 6.5%) | $1,646 |
| **Total** | **$1,646** |

## Nearby Schools

- **Elementary:** Oakwood Elem.
- **Middle:** Hannibal Middle
- **High:** Hannibal Sr. High

## Key Amenities

- Basement

## Property Highlights

- Built in 2017
- 1.87 acre lot
- 2 parking spaces

## Description

### Agent Description
Hold on to your hats, folks—54291 Johnny Trail in HANNIBAL, MO is ready to steal your heart!
This charming single-family stunner offers 4 spacious bedrooms and 2 full baths, making it the perfect place to stretch out, settle in, and start making memories. Built in 2017, this home still sparkles with modern style and feels fresh, welcoming, and move-in ready.
The large kitchen is the heart of the home—ideal for whipping up weeknight dinners, hosting holiday feasts, or gathering everyone for late-night snacks. Downstairs, the newly constructed basement is an entertainer’s dream, offering plenty of room for a pool table, workout equipment, or cheering on your favorite teams at the bar while guests mingle.
Step outside and enjoy the freedom of 1.8 beautiful acres—perfect for outdoor fun, peaceful evenings, or simply soaking in the space and serenity.
From sunrise mornings to game-night excitement, this home truly has it all. This must-see property is calling your name—don’t keep it waiting!

## Location

- **Address:** 54291 Johnny Trail, Hannibal, MO 63401
- **County:** Ralls
- **Neighborhood:** Bunn's Lake Estates
- **Coordinates:** 39.66920321, -91.36544371
- **Google Maps:** https://www.google.com/maps?q=39.66920321,-91.36544371

## Listing Agent

- **Name:** Jennifer Ruhl
- **Brokerage:** Ravenscraft Realty
- **Phone:** 5732210555
- **Email:** jenniferruhl1@gmail.com

## Primary Photo

![54291 Johnny Trail - Primary Photo](http://lh.rdcpix.com/77c21b121b547ce2f6d8d9c775fbfacal-f491358638r.jpg)

*26 total photos available on [listing page](https://www.propertysimple.com/listing/54291-johnny-trail-hannibal-mo-63401-25081198)*

---

**MLS#:** 25081198 | **Updated:** 2026-04-24
**Source:** listhub

*Copyright © 2026 Mid America Regional Information Systems, Inc. All rights reserved. All information provided by the listing agent/broker is deemed reliable but is not guaranteed and should be independently verified.*

[View on PropertySimple](https://www.propertysimple.com/listing/54291-johnny-trail-hannibal-mo-63401-25081198)

---

## Structured Data

```json
{
  "@context": "https://schema.org",
  "@type": "RealEstateListing",
  "name": "54291 Johnny Trail, Hannibal, MO 63401",
  "description": "Hold on to your hats, folks—54291 Johnny Trail in HANNIBAL, MO is ready to steal your heart!\nThis charming single-family stunner offers 4 spacious bedrooms and 2 full baths, making it the perfect place to stretch out, settle in, and start making memories. Built in 2017, this home still sparkles with modern style and feels fresh, welcoming, and move-in ready.\nThe large kitchen is the heart of the home—ideal for whipping up weeknight dinners, hosting holiday feasts, or gathering everyone for late-",
  "url": "https://www.propertysimple.com/listing/54291-johnny-trail-hannibal-mo-63401-25081198",
  "image": "http://lh.rdcpix.com/77c21b121b547ce2f6d8d9c775fbfacal-f491358638r.jpg",
  "datePosted": "2026-04-24",
  "price": 379900,
  "priceCurrency": "USD",
  "address": {
    "@type": "PostalAddress",
    "streetAddress": "54291 Johnny Trail",
    "addressLocality": "Hannibal",
    "addressRegion": "MO",
    "postalCode": "63401",
    "addressCountry": "US"
  },
  "geo": {
    "@type": "GeoCoordinates",
    "latitude": 39.66920321,
    "longitude": -91.36544371
  },
  "numberOfRooms": 4,
  "numberOfBathroomsTotal": 2,
  "floorSize": {
    "@type": "QuantitativeValue",
    "value": 2844,
    "unitCode": "FTK"
  },
  "yearBuilt": 2017
}
```